Amarildo Rodi, for years lives in Rome, Italy, and works at a foundation that is near the sick.
A few months ago, he met Pope Francis and presented him with a painting of the Church of Lachi. His experience at this meeting, he decided to share it with show viewers “Fte at 5” in Top Channel.
It was December eight. I knew the meeting was that day and I was at work. I was interested and learned that I was not part of the list. I call my colleague and tell him I'm on the list. I wasn't, but in two hours I did my best to be part of it. I had a painting of the Church of Lacchi and wanted to donate to the Pope. I chose the Church of Lacchi because it's a good place for us Catholics.
There were people in front of me in line. I was well dressed that day, had a bag on my shoulder, and put the painting inside. I tell my colleague, give it to her. If you have a gift, give it to me. I took out the gift bag. Believe me, my hands were so cold. He gave me his hand. I don't know what to say. He saw the Albanian flag I had in my pocket, he took the gift and said thank you to me”, Amarildo said.
